

The Temple of the Emerald Buddha, Wat Phra Kaew, is a stunning temple complex in the heart of Bangkok, housing the revered Emerald Buddha statue. This sacred site is a masterpiece of Thai architecture, adorned with intricate details and vibrant colors that reflect the rich cultural heritage of Thailand.
Home to the famous reclining Buddha, Wat Pho is one of Bangkok's oldest and largest temples, showcasing exquisite architecture and intricate murals.

Jok is a Thai rice porridge served with minced pork or chicken, typically garnished with spring onions, ginger, and a drizzle of soy or fish sauce. It has a creamy texture and savory flavor.
Pad Thai is a stir-fried noodle dish made with rice noodles, eggs, tofu or shrimp, bean sprouts, and peanuts, often flavored with tamarind paste, fish sauce, and lime. It’s a savory and tangy dish.
Moo Pad Krapow is a stir-fried dish featuring minced pork cooked with holy basil, garlic, and chili. It's typically served with jasmine rice and a fried egg on top, delivering a spicy and aromatic experience.
